Shri. Pralhad Joshi Union Minister of Parliamentary Affairs visited Central Coalfields Ltd
New Delhi: Shri. Pralhad Joshi, Hon’ble Union Minister of Parliamentary Affairs, Coal and Mines, Govt. of India visited Central Coalfields Ltd. He paid floral tributes at the Martyrs Memorial and addressed the employees of Central Coalfields Ltd. He reviewed the Vehicle Tracking System (VTS) of CCL and chaired a review meeting of Central Coalfields Ltd. in Ranchi. Shri. Joshi also inaugurated ‘CCL Bhawan’, a green building with a 4 star GRIHA rating. Shri. Gopal Singh, CMD, CCL and other senior management of CCL were present on the occasion.
